Logo Design Brief
We run a beautiful small non-profit that represents the works of a consciousness teacher who taught monastic meditative practices. We are seeking a logo design to place on the jacket of some of his books, on the website and on other collateral materials. One idea is to use his signature, which is attached. This signature will need some clean up and/or deepening of lines and color tone but is iconic to his memory. We are also open to a design using Serif type. The logo should be designed so that the two words run horizontal across the page as well as can sit as a stacked identity.
We are also interested in an abreviation of the design with the letters LJA.
Words to describe the ethos of the organization are:
India, ancient yet modern, consciousness, meditation,
Kashmir Valley, Bhagavad Gita, Shiva Sutras, Wisdom
